A well-designed glass box acts as a controlled micro-environment. It manages humidity, blocks UV exposure, and minimizes particulate contact—conditions that determine whether a hand-stitched quilt remains intact after decades or fades to brittle whispers. Unlike generic display cases, optimized craft boxes integrate a calibrated viewing perspective: a deliberate 45-degree angle that avoids glare while preserving surface detail. This is not about aesthetics alone—it’s about creating a consistent visual frame that lets the object speak without distortion.

The difference lies in precision. High-end glass boxes use low-iron laminates—glass with fewer impurities—to eliminate green tints that obscure subtle color shifts in natural dyes or hand-painted finishes. Coatings that reduce glare by 80% don’t just improve visibility; they preserve the integrity of visual cues—faint brush strokes, fiber textures, thread variation—elements that convey craftsmanship’s soul. This level of control transforms passive viewing into active engagement, where every crease and dye blend becomes legible.

Yet, the glass box is only as effective as its integration into broader conservation strategy. A pristine display case without humidity control or UV filtering fails to protect. Equally, a craft left in a generic container—even glass—risks long-term degradation. The true value lies in holistic alignment: stable temperature, low oxygen exposure, and minimal handling, all reinforced by a view optimized for both conservation and narrative clarity.
